Artificial Intelligence (AI) agents have emerged as a transformative force in various sectors, reshaping how we interact with technology and automate processes. AI agents are systems that are able to perceive their environment and make decisions on their own. They can be as simple as programs based on rules or as complicated as algorithms that learn themselves. Their applications span customer service, industrial automation, personal assistance, and much more, leading to increased efficiency and personalized experiences. However, the rise of AI agents also brings forth challenges, including ethical considerations and technical limitations that must be addressed. This article explores the definition, types, workings, applications, benefits, challenges, and future trends of AI agents, providing a comprehensive understanding of their impact on society.
AI Agents as Defined What Constitutes an AI Agent?
An AI agent is essentially a software entity designed to perform tasks autonomously. Think of it as a virtual assistant that can interpret data, make decisions, and execute actions based on its environment. These agents can range from simple chatbots responding to queries to complex systems capable of analyzing large datasets and learning from them. Any AI agent’s ability to perceive and respond to its surroundings while having a good time is at its core; after all, who doesn’t want a digital buddy who can make sense of the chaos? Differentiating AI Agents from Other AI Technologies
While all AI technologies aim to mimic human intelligence in some form, not all qualify as agents. The key distinction lies in autonomy and proactivity. Like a parrot that only talks when you ask, traditional AI systems might react only to user input. In contrast, AI agents actively seek information, make decisions, and take initiative without constant human prompting (like that friend who always suggests new places to eat). In a nutshell, you are most likely dealing with an AI agent if it possesses its own mind and a propensity for self-directed action. Types of AI Agents
Reactive Agents
In the AI world, reactive agents are the wallflowers. They lack memory and operate purely based on current stimuli, reacting to their environment in real-time. Picture a basic spam filter: it analyzes incoming messages and acts accordingly without pondering past interactions. While efficient, reactive agents can be limited in their complexity—great for straightforward tasks, but not your go-to for a deep philosophical discussion.
Agents with a Plan Deliberative agents are the thinkers among AI agents. They evaluate options, evaluate situations, and plan actions in accordance with a robust internal world model. Imagine a chess player who anticipates your moves five steps ahead; that’s a deliberative agent in action. They have memory, can learn from experiences, and are typically used in more complex scenarios where strategy and foresight are crucial—like launching a surprise birthday party for your friend.
Hybrid Agents
Hybrid agents resemble the AI family’s overachievers. They combine the best traits of reactive and deliberative agents, allowing them to act swiftly when necessary while also engaging in deeper cognitive processes. This makes them incredibly versatile, capable of adapting to various situations while maintaining efficiency. They’re the Swiss Army knives of AI agents, ready to tackle a multitude of tasks, from navigating a driving route to managing a home security system.
How AI Agents Work
Fundamental Elements of AI Agents Perception, reasoning, and action are the three fundamental parts of every AI agent. Perception involves gathering data from the environment through sensors or input systems—think of it as the agent’s eyes and ears. Reasoning is where the magic happens, as the agent processes the collected information to make decisions. Finally, action is the agent’s execution phase, where it puts its plans into motion. It’s a bit like an orchestra: each part must harmonize for a beautiful performance.
Learning Mechanisms
AI agents learn and adapt through various mechanisms, including supervised learning, reinforcement learning, and unsupervised learning. The agent is guided through examples by a tutor (the data) in supervised learning. Reinforcement learning is akin to a game where the agent learns through trial and error, receiving ‘rewards’ for good play (like an overly proud parent at a soccer match). The free spirit of unsupervised learning enables the agent to discover patterns and insights without external guidance. Together, these methods enable AI agents to improve over time—making them smarter and, dare we say, more charming with every interaction.
Interaction with the Environment
AI agents interact with their environment through a feedback loop, continuously gathering information and adjusting their actions accordingly. This means they’re not just passive observers; they’re actively engaged participants. From recognizing voices in voice-activated assistants to navigating obstacles in robotic applications, their capability to adapt and respond enhances their performance and ensures they stay relevant to user needs. Think of it as a dance—where the AI agent leads based on the rhythm of its surroundings.
The Uses of AI Agents Customer Service and Support
AI agents are revolutionizing the customer service landscape, stepping in as chatbots and virtual assistants that can handle inquiries 24/7. They’re like the customer service reps who never take a coffee break, fielding questions, troubleshooting issues, and providing support at lightning speed. Not only does this enhance user experience, but it also ensures businesses can scale operations without burning out their human staff. They won’t, however, take the place of your favorite barista’s latte art. Automation in Industries
In various industries, AI agents are the unseen heroes automating mundane tasks, from inventory management in warehouses to predictive maintenance in manufacturing. They sift through data, identify inefficiencies, and optimize processes—turning those tedious, time-consuming tasks into a breeze. Gone are the days of paper-pushing; with AI agents at the helm, industries can function like well-oiled machines. Just don’t let them take over the world… yet.
Personal Assistants and Smart Home Devices
From Siri to Alexa, AI agents have made their way into our homes, facilitating everything from setting reminders to controlling smart devices. These personal assistants are not only helpful but are also becoming more intuitive, learning user preferences and adapting to individual lifestyles. Imagine coming home to an ambient environment tailored perfectly to your whims, thanks to your smart home AI agent—it’s like having a personal butler, sans the tuxedo and mustache.Benefits of Using AI Agents
Increased Efficiency and Productivity
AI agents can handle repetitive tasks faster than you can say “artificial intelligence.” By automating mundane duties like scheduling meetings or sorting emails, they free up human brains for the creative, strategic heavy lifting. Think of them as your tireless office buddies, ready to tackle those time-consuming tasks while you focus on impressing everyone with your knack for problem-solving.
Cost Reduction
Who doesn’t love saving a little cash? AI agents can significantly reduce operational costs. By cutting down on human resource needs for routine tasks, businesses can allocate those savings toward more exciting ventures—like perhaps finally investing in that break room espresso machine. Plus, with fewer errors and increased accuracy, the financial benefits really do add up.
Personalization and User Experience
Users can be made to feel like they have their own personal assistant by AI agents. They analyze preferences and behavior, allowing for a highly customized experience. Whether it’s recommending the next Netflix binge or curating a shopping list that screams “you,” AI agents are here to make your life just a tad more delightful—and let’s be honest, who doesn’t want that?
Challenges and Limitations of AI Agents
Ethical Considerations
Having a lot of power comes with a lot of responsibility, and AI agents have a lot of power! The ethical dilemmas surrounding privacy, consent, and data handling can lead to some serious gray areas. As these agents become more prevalent, ensuring that they operate with fairness and transparency will be an ongoing challenge. We don’t want them turning into the digital equivalent of that friend who always overshares at parties.
Technical Limitations
Despite their impressive capabilities, AI agents aren’t flawless. They can struggle with complex tasks that require human intuition or emotional intelligence. Misunderstandings can occur, leading to the occasional mix-up that leaves you scratching your head—like that time your virtual assistant booked a flight to the wrong city. Oops!
Dependence on Data Quality
AI is only as good as the data it’s trained on, making data quality a big deal. Garbage in, garbage out, as they say. If the training data is biased or inaccurate, the AI agent will follow suit, potentially leading to bad recommendations or decisions. It’s a reminder that even though AI agents can be clever, they need a solid foundation to stand tall.
Future Trends in AI Agents
Advancements in Machine Learning
Machine learning is the rocket fuel for AI agents, and its advancements promise to make these agents even smarter. As algorithms improve and more sophisticated techniques (hello, deep learning!) emerge, we can expect AI agents to become not just better problem solvers, but also sharper at predicting our needs before we even know we have them. Next stop: AI agents anticipating your snack cravings!
Integration with Other Technologies
AI agents are cozying up with other technologies like IoT and blockchain








